Abstract:Aiming at the influence of generation-load uncertainties on the capacity configuration of the photovoltaic storage system, a multi-objective optimization method considering uncertainties in meteorological parameters, building disturbance factors, personnel density, and air-conditioning system is proposed,constructing a multi-objective optimization model of the rural residential photovoltaic storage system with the objectives of minimizing the annual operating cost of the system and maximizing the self-consumption rate SCR and the self-supply rate SSR, and the modified adaptive weighted particle swarm optimization algorithm is used to solve the problem. The results show that: the relative deviations of the maximum and minimum values of the average and peak loads of the building are 41.08% and 71.65%, respectively, and the relative deviations of the maximum and minimum values of the peak power, average power, and annual power generation of PV are 3.55%, 23.65%, and 23.91%, respectively; The optimal combination of photovoltaic and battery capacity can be found using multi-objective optimization methods; By adopting the SCR and SSR with the highest frequency of occurrence within a relative deviation of 7% as representative values for the technical performance indicators of the PV-storage system, the capacity allocation indicators for photovoltaic and battery storage in rural residential buildings in the Changsha area were derived.
